Bath Rugby face off against Newcastle Red Bulls in Gallagher Premiership Round 2 on Sat 25th September 2021 at Recreation Ground. Kick-off in the UK is scheduled for 15:00. In South Africa it’s at 16:00 SAST, 03:00 NZST in New Zealand, 00:00 AEST in Australia and 07:00 EST in the US.
Bath Rugby won the last encounter but Bath Rugby are in the best form of their last 5 games.
Heading into the fixture the two sides are separated by just 1 place in the league table with Newcastle Red Bulls in 12th and Bath Rugby in 13th underlining just how tight this match could be.
The official squads for Bath Rugby vs Newcastle Red Bulls will become available around 24- 48 hours before kick-off. Teams can still make changes up to an hour before the match however.
